Byfords is centrally located and within walking distance of shops and other attractions, making it a convenient choice for travellers with disabilities. Guests appreciated the ease of accessing their rooms on the ground level without having to navigate stairs or lifts. However, those with specific needs, including wheelchair users, may struggle as the accessible rooms come with a toilet that is too high, almost dangerous. Limited parking is also an issue, but the hotel tries to accommodate guests as best they can. Despite these limitations, guests who do not require specific accessibility features appreciated the rooms and the hotel overall and would return if changes were made.

The Three Horseshoes garners consistently positive reviews, making it a highly recommended destination for travelers seeking a tranquil countryside retreat. Located in a picturesque and serene village near the stunning coastlines of Wells, Holkham and the North Norfolk coast, the hotel perfectly balances a remote feel with convenient access to local attractions and amenities. The lovely countryside setting, traditional layout and dog-friendly atmosphere, complemented by free parking, add to its charm.
Guests are particularly enthusiastic about the exceptional breakfast and dinner offerings. The breakfast menu is lauded for its variety and quality, making use of fresh and local produce with the full English breakfast being a standout favorite. Service during breakfast is consistently praised for its friendliness and attentiveness, creating a relaxed and enjoyable dining experience. Evening meals, especially the homemade pies and burgers, receive high commendations for their taste and quality. Despite a few occasional comments about inconsistent meal preparations, the overall dining experience is overwhelmingly positive.
The accommodations at The Three Horseshoes are noted for their meticulous cleanliness and comfort. Rooms are spacious and beautifully decorated, blending modern amenities with the historic charm of the property. Guests appreciate the large, luxurious bathrooms, high-quality bed linens and thoughtful amenities, ensuring a restful night's sleep. The beds, often described as extremely comfortable, contribute significantly to the guests' overall comfort.
The hotel's staff consistently receive glowing reviews for their friendliness and helpfulness, enhancing the welcoming atmosphere. Their attentiveness and personal touches make guests feel right at home, further elevating the overall experience.
While the WiFi signal in the rooms has some limitations, the reliable connection in the pub and restaurant areas ensures that guests can stay connected if needed. The parking situation is generally well-received with free and ample parking spaces available, although some guests note that the car park can be muddy and relatively unlit.
For those traveling with pets, The Three Horseshoes excels in providing dog-friendly amenities and services. The warm welcome extended to canine guests, the availability of ground floor rooms and the enclosed garden spaces make it an ideal choice for travelers with dogs.
In summary, The Three Horseshoes stands out for its serene location, exceptional food, comfortable and clean accommodations, friendly staff and welcoming atmosphere for both guests and their pets. It offers a well-rounded experience that combines relaxation and adventure, making it a delightful destination on the Norfolk coast.
